    Here a solution that David Creamer gave
    (<a class="moz-txt-link-freetext" href="http://www.IDEAStraining.com">http://www.IDEAStraining.com</a>):<br>
    <br>
    "If the file is Word 2007 (and presumably 2010), you can make a copy
    of the<br>
    file, change the extension from .docx to .zip.<br>
    <br>
    Uncompress the zip and the graphics (Word optimized and originals)
    will all<br>
    be in a media folder. (This works for PowerPoint 2007 too.)<br>
    <br>
    I have not tried taking a Word 2003 file and saving it as 2007 to
    process<br>
    this way, so I don't know if it will work or not."<br>
